A traffic collision on Interstate 5 South in Los Angeles, CA, disrupted morning traffic today. The incident occurred around 5:02 AM when a black Honda collided with a concrete wall, leaving the vehicle non-drivable. This collision blocked the fourth lane, leading to significant delays for commuters during the busy morning rush hour.
Emergency response units quickly arrived at the scene to manage traffic flow and ensure safety. With the fourth lane obstructed, drivers experienced backups as they navigated around the incident. The presence of emergency personnel helped to control the situation, minimizing further complications on the roadway.
By 5:32 AM, a tow truck was on-site to remove the disabled vehicle, which had been blacked out and obstructing traffic. The roadway was cleared shortly thereafter, but motorists were advised to remain cautious as residual congestion lingered in the area.
